During our recent trip to Georgia, we completed additional research on the WOOTEN family as follows: SOME FAMILIES FROM THE HEART OF GEORGIA by Marilu Burch Smallwood (1988) " Thomas Wooten (1720-1791) served as a Lieutenant under Col. Holman Freeman, 7th GA Regt. He received bounty land in Wilkes County, GA, for his service. Thomas married (1) Sarah Rabun. Their children are: (1) THOMAS; (2) LEMUEL; (3) JAMES; (4) RICHARD born in 1760, died in Wilkes Co, GA in 1798. He served as a Lieutenant in Capt. John Pope's Co., 7th Battalion, Col. Holman Freeman. He married LUCRETIA CADE; (5) MARY married JAMES CADE; (6) JOHN; (7) DANIEL; (8) ROBERT. See page 184 of Roster of Revolutionary Soldiers of Georgia by Mrs. H.H. McCall for records of THOMAS WOOTEN, Rev. soldier, as cited. Katharine Wooten of Eastman, GA, Dodge Co., joined DAR on Col. Thomas Wooten's war record. She descended through his son, Lieut. Richard Wooten of NC." I have names of additional children for this family that are not recored in this text. Joan Will of James Wooten Georgia Butts County In the name of God Amen, I, James Wooten being in a low state of health, but of sound mind and memory do make and ordain this my last will and testament. Item 1st I do yield my soul to that God who gave it and my body to the dust from whence it came to be buried in a Christianlike manner according to the discretion of my executors. Item 2nd I do next ordain that all my just debts should be paid and next it is my wish that all my estate both real and personal should be kept together untill my oldest child Edmund Flewellen Wooten comes of age and then that an equal division of the property should be made between my wife Anne Wooten, Addison Almarian Wooten, Seaborn Lawrence Wooten, Simeon Wooten making the arrangements, so that my wife shall have the house and plantation to hold during her natural life, and afterwards to be divided among my children. It is my further wish that my stock to the use of my family should remain. Item 3rd I do next appoint and ordain Etheldred McClendon and James Peevy executors to this my last will and testament to do all matters and things pertaining to the above as they in their discretion shall think fit. Signed James Wooten Farewell Jones Bartholomew Stile James Ransom Proven 3rd August 1828. Recorded Butts County Will - Administration of Estates 1826 - 1841, p 48).
Several people have asked about PERSI. I thought I'd post this to the list to explain. PERSI stands for PERiodocal Source Index. I found it at http://www.ancestry.com . The name of the site is Ancestry. It has 226 searchable databases. 3 of them are free (SSDI, World Tree, I can't remember the other name) . All of the databases are free right now until Jan. 1. It is a 7 day trial thing. PERSI lists the articles on a subject that you give it. I put in Wooten and got the list I posted. It will give you the name of the article, the name of the publication, the volume it is in. If you click on the name of the publication, it will tell you the address of the genealogical society that publishes it, where known copies are. I would suggest asking at your local FHC for copies of the publications. Joan Wooten -

Dear Friends, An excerpt from a worn copy of a page from the following book: From TENNESSE COUSINS A History of Tennessee People (date of publication unknown, page number unclear) Coffee County Tennessee "JESSE WOOTEN AND HIS FAMILY OF COFFEE COUNTY, TENNESSEE JESSE WOOTEN, one of the first Justices of the Peace of COFFEE COUNTY, was originally of the lower part of WARREN County, and it is believed a son of William Wooten, who died December 1, 1834 at the age of 90 years and is buried in the Old Blue Springs Primitive Baptist Graveyard in Lower Warren County. These Wootens were related to the Laynes and Mcabees of the same section. W.H. Jonathan and (possibly) Lucy Kempton Wooten were also members of the Jesse-William Wooten family. They came originally from Virginia but came to Tennessee perhaps from down in Georgia. " Della
